Output 66e3ef2464acdcd768f5280321c7df0536ab61fe891480543eadd2aa623b9a70:1

value
933924
script pubkey
OP_0 OP_PUSHBYTES_20 b3621566d1b69e4242d3bc97d5388907673e4373
address
bc1qkd3p2ek3k60yysknhjta2wyfqannusmng3xk5x
transaction
66e3ef2464acdcd768f5280321c7df0536ab61fe891480543eadd2aa623b9a70
spent
true